Clinical definition (Orphanet)
X-linked spastic paraplegia type 34 is a pure form of spastic paraplegia characterized by late childhood- to early adulthood-onset of slowly spastic paraplegia with spastic gait and lower limb hyperreflexia, brisk tendon reflexes and ankle clonus. Lower limb pain and reduced lower limb vibratory sense is also reported in some older adult patients.
How rare: <1 / 1 000 000 — fewer than one in a million. In a city the size of Kolkata, that might mean on the order of fifteen people.
